Fe 3 + cation gives a prussian blue precipitate on addition of potassium ferrocyanide solution due to the formation of

Options

  1. AFe H 2 O 6 2 Fe CN 6
  2. BFe 2 Fe CN 6 2
  3. CFe 3 Fe OH 2 CN 4 2
  4. DFe 4 Fe CN 6 3

Correct answer

D. Fe 4 Fe CN 6 3

Step-by-step solution

Ferric ion forms a prussian blue precipitate due to the formation of F e 4 F e C N 6 3 . In this method, to a portion of sodium fusion extract, freshly prepared ferrous sulphate F e S O 4 solution is added and warmed. Then about 2 to 3 drops of F e C l 3 solution are added and acidified with conc. H C l . The appearance of a prussian blue colour indicates the presence of nitrogen.
